    25 Indian Fishermen Arrested for Beating Navy Officers on Sea

    Three navy officers who went to arrest a group of fishermen who had come to catch fish illegally in the Sri Lankan waters were beaten with sticks and injured.

    This attack took place on the night of the last 9th at a distance of about 10 kilometers from the coast of Point Pedro.

    After informing the officials of Kankasanturai Naval Base about the attack by the Indian sailors on a group of the navy, the additional troops arrived at the sea border and arrested 25 Indian people with two Indian boats who surrounded and attacked the officers.

    These Indians have been produced in court after being handed over to the Coast Guard Department. There, the 25 fishermen have been remanded until the 22nd.
